About INNOVISIONINNOVISION is a €3.1 million Marie Skłodowska-Curie COFUND programme coordinated by South East Technological University. The programme will recruit 12 postdoctoral fellows across two calls (6 researchers to be recruited each round). INNOVISION focuses on translational vision researcg, ocular drug delivery, medical devices, and public and patient involvement (PPI) in research. Fellows will undertake cutting-edge research, supported by a network of academic, clinical, industry, and patient advocacy partners.Fellows will be employed by one of the programme’s recruiting organisation (South East Technological University or Experimentica), with opportunities for international, intersectoral, and/or interdisciplinary secondments lasting 1–9 months.Research AreasApplications are welcome from candidates with expertise relevant to vision research and related fields, including but not limited to:

Eligibility Criteria
Applicants must hold a doctoral degree (PhD or equivalent) or have at least four years of full-time equivalent research experience.
Applicants must not have resided or carried out their main activity (work, study, etc.) in the country of the recruiting organisation for more than 12 months in the 36 months prior to the call deadline (MSCA mobility rule).
Applicants must be fluent in English (written and spoken).
